Why Speed-to-Lead Wins in Competitive Service Markets

Industry data consistently shows that the first service provider to make contact with a new lead is 5-7x more likely to win the job than the second responder. In competitive markets where consumers submit inquiries to multiple providers simultaneously, the difference between a 2-minute response and a 20-minute response can mean the difference between a $5,000 project and a missed opportunity.

Speed-to-lead is not just about answering the phone — it encompasses the entire first-contact experience. The fastest responders use automated text confirmations, same-day estimate scheduling, and pre-built proposal templates to compress the time from initial inquiry to signed agreement. Service providers who invest in lead response infrastructure consistently report close rates 40-60% higher than competitors who rely on traditional callback workflows.

Why Exclusive Leads Outperform Shared Lead Services

The economics of exclusive versus shared leads are straightforward but frequently misunderstood. A shared lead that costs $30 but is sent to four competitors has an effective cost-per-acquisition of $120 or more when you factor in the reduced close rate from competing on speed and price. An exclusive lead that costs $80 but converts at 3-4x the rate of shared leads produces a dramatically lower cost-per-acquisition and higher customer lifetime value.

Beyond the math, exclusive leads change the dynamic of the initial customer interaction. When a homeowner knows they are speaking with a recommended provider rather than one of several competing bidders, the conversation shifts from price justification to scope discussion. Service providers report that exclusive leads produce larger average project sizes because the customer is not anchored to the lowest competing bid. The compounding effect of higher close rates, larger tickets, and better customer relationships makes exclusive leads the clear choice for providers focused on sustainable growth.
